Why Can’t I Propose in The Sims 3? A Comprehensive Guide
So, you’ve got two Sims head-over-heels, the romantic music is playing, and you’re ready for the big question… but the “Propose” option is nowhere to be found! Frustrating, right? There are several reasons why this might be happening in The Sims 3. Let’s break it down:
The most common reason you can’t propose is that you haven’t built up enough of a romantic relationship. The game has a hidden “relationship score,” and proposing requires a certain threshold. Think of it like a romantic meter that needs to be filled. You need to move past basic flirting and into deeper, more meaningful interactions.
Another key factor is the relationship status. Your Sims need to be at least “Boyfriend” and “Girlfriend” before you can propose marriage. The game uses a hierarchical relationship system. Skipping steps is not an option!

Troubleshooting Your Proposal Problems
Let’s dive into some of the key areas that could be hindering your Sims’ journey to the altar:
1. The Relationship Status
As mentioned above, this is crucial. Make sure your Sims are officially Boyfriend and Girlfriend. If the “Propose Going Steady” option isn’t appearing, you’re not ready for marriage yet. Focus on building romantic interactions. Once the Sim accepts, it is time to level up your actions for marriage.
2. Building Romantic Relationship Points
Proposing in The Sims 3 isn’t just about doing one or two romantic interactions. It’s about creating a consistent chain of romantic gestures. Keep flirting and using romantic actions. A single interaction is not going to cut it. Keep doing more!
3. The “Irresistible” Moodlet
This is your golden ticket! After a series of successful romantic interactions, you should see a moodlet indicating that one Sim finds the other “Extremely Irresistible.” This moodlet signifies that you’ve reached the necessary romantic threshold, and the “Propose” option should now appear under the Romantic interaction menu.
4. The Romantic Interaction Tab
Double-check that you’re looking in the right place! The “Propose” option is always located within the Romantic interaction category. If you’re clicking on “Friendly” or “Funny” interactions, you’re in the wrong place. Tap on the other sim and select the option.
5. Potential Glitches and Bugs
Sometimes, the game just glitches. If you’ve done everything right and the “Propose” option still isn’t there, try these solutions:
- Reset the Sim: Open the cheat console (Ctrl + Shift + C) and type
resetsim [Sim's First Name] [Sim's Last Name]
and press Enter. This resets the Sim’s state and can sometimes fix glitches. - Restart the Game: A simple restart can often clear up temporary bugs.
- Travel to Another Lot: Sometimes, simply traveling to another lot can refresh the game and make the option appear.
6. Conflicts in Mods
If you are using mods, especially those that alter relationship mechanics, they might be interfering with the proposal process. Try removing any relationship-related mods and see if the issue resolves itself.
